This review is from: Tovolo Freezer Jewel Pop Molds, Set of 6 (Kitchen)
I wanted reasonably sized molds to make some homemade foren yogurt/fruit pops for my 2 year old. In their photo, these looked to be an appropriate size (she doesn't need a huge popscicle!) But when i opened the box, I couldn't believe how TINY these molds are!! Now, it's still a good size for young children (although I think even my daughter could eat 2 of these easily at a time!), but the annoying thing is, I would literally have to only make up maybe one cup's worth of yogurt/fruit puree at a time! That's ridiculous! If i'm going to the trouble to make a batch of puree in my blender, I want to at least have more than 1 cup's worth! What a waste of time otherwise. So, I'll either have to by probably 2 or even 3 more of these trays to make it worth my while, or just buy a larger set that holds more liquid. I didn't see fluid ounces in the description, but upon looking closer, i now see that they had that info in the shipping dimensions (?!) (only 0.8 ounces!). Otherwise, they look nice, and having separate pieces is convenient for thawing only what you need... But plan on buying a few trays if you want to blend more than 6 ounces at a time!

This review is from: Tovolo Freezer Jewel Pop Molds, Set of 6 (Kitchen)
We bought this model and the Green Star molds as well. These jewel's handles seem to be of thinner plastic than the green stars handles. Also, unlike the green star handle (which is one solid piece), the jewel handles are made from 2 interlocking pieces of plastic. Within the first day one became broken. Then one of the tabs on the bottom of the mold cup (the piece that allows it to clip on the tray) broke!

I called Tovolo (check their website for the number), quickly spoke with a live rep, and they politely sent out free replacements! I am very happy with this smaller popsicle mold - it's really perfect for the little ones. Just enough for a snack. My only caution is that you must run them under HOT water for a few seconds to loosen the treat inside. If you twist or pull by the handle - it will break. The best removal method is after running under hot water, I squeeze the mold gently with my fist and then using my thumbs, I push the circle cap off instead of using the handle to pull it out. Works every time!
